State bill AB5, also known as … datation c14 prixWebMar 16, 2024 · California Commercial Truck Weight Limits. California state law dictates that trucks must not exceed 80,000 pounds in weight, with no more than 20,000 pounds per axle. This regulation serves a dual purpose of ensuring safety on the roads and protecting infrastructure from damage. marzetti sweet chili sauceWebJan 13, 2024 · Driver classification laws.
